Every published artifact of the LotPulse occupancy feed carries verifiable provenance metadata so plugin authors can confirm exactly which source revision produced the binary they integrate against. The Harbrook build farm signs each artifact at packaging time, and the signature chains back to the commit that passed the full occupancy-simulation suite. Before distributing a plugin, verify that your target build matches a published attestation. Each attestation record begins with the token shown below.

session token of kawip-bahaf = htk9_8600e190b

## Deployment

The Marlowe ledger service partitions its events table by month. Each release, the migration job pre-creates partitions three months ahead; if a partition is missing, writes fail hard rather than landing in a default partition. Before promoting a build, confirm the partition-maintenance cron ran in staging and check the partition count matches the calendar. Rollbacks never drop partitions, so reverting is safe. The partitioning behavior and retention window are controlled by the values below.

service settings:
[casax]
port = 6379
team = rusir
host = casax.zemvarhq.corp
region = outer-4
access_code = ac_9808ce
timeout_ms = 1500

Gross-Margin Review (Managers Only)

This page summarises the quarterly gross-margin review for the board. Margins on the Larkspell line slipped two points, mainly due to input costs; the Denholt line held steady. Procurement is renegotiating supplier terms, and a pricing adjustment is under consideration. Full workings are attached. The confidential note on business plans appears below.

board note of yagaf-yawig: Project Gorvan slips by one quarter because of the staffing delay.

## Deployment — Telemetry Compression (Brightcask)

Brightcask compresses telemetry payloads at the collector tier before forwarding to long-term storage. Deploy compression changes gradually: raise the level on one collector, watch CPU headroom and end-to-end lag for thirty minutes, then roll forward. Decompression is backward compatible across two releases, so rollbacks are safe. When paged, first verify the collectors are running with the expected settings, shown below.

config for kafof-bawef:
holath:
  log_level: debug
  metrics_host: metrics.holath.qorvelsys.internal
  pin: 2191
  pool_size: 32